@mechellehuber53525 жыл бұрын
It's the only park that is completely owned and operated by Six Flags and started out an established Six Flags location. I think what makes the employees friendlier than those at other parks is the atmosphere created by management. They encourage employees to (reasonably) interact with guests in a way that is personal. They don't stop employees from conversing with guests about stuff unrelated to their job and employees can personalize their spiels if they're working a ride as long as they mention the key points they are supposed to hit. When I worked Boomerang I would give a trivia fact about it previously being the Flashback and would ask the guests what game they wanted to play while the train was pulling up the first lift. Sometimes I played Marco Polo...only I would be Polo and would have to listen for their Marco.
